Determines the format of the AMR header.
[0] = Non-standard multiple frames packing in a single RTP
frame. Each frame has a CMR and TOC header.
[1] = Reserved.
[2] = AMR Header according to RFC 3267 Octet Aligned
header format.
[3] = AMR is passed using the AMR IF2 format.

Fax transport mode used by the device.
[0]
Disable = transparent mode.
[1]
T.38 Relay = (default).
[2]
Bypass.
[3] Events Only.
Note:
This parameter is overridden by the parameter
IsFaxUsed. If the parameter IsFaxUsed is set to 1 (T.38
Relay) or 3 (Fax Fallback), then FaxTransportMode is always
set to 1 (T.38 relay).

Number of times that each fax relay payload is retransmitted
to the network.
[0]
= No redundancy (default).
[1]
= One packet redundancy.
[2] = Two packet redundancy.
Note:
This parameter is applicable only to non-V.21 packets.
Maximum rate (in bps), at which fax relay messages are
transmitted (outgoing calls).
[0]
2400 = 2.4 kbps.
[1]
4800 = 4.8 kbps.
[2]
7200 = 7.2 kbps.
[3]
9600 = 9.6 kbps.
[4]
12000 = 12.0 kbps.
[5] 14400 = 14.4 kbps (default).
Note: The rate is negotiated between the sides (i.e., the
device adapts to the capabilities of the remote side).
